Quotable quotes for whatever purpose...

Begin somewhere. You cannot build a reputation on what you intend to do.

Liz Smith, journalist


Courage is resistance to fear, mastery of fear-not the absence of fear.

Mark Twain, author


Making the simple complicated is commonplace. Making the complicated simple, awesomely simple, that's creativity.

Charles Mingus, jazz musician and composer


Enthusiasm is one of the great engines of success. Nothing great was ever achieved without enthusiasm.

Ralph Waldo Emerson, author, philosophe


If we don't change, we don't grow. If we don't grow, we aren't really living.

Gail Sheehy, author


Setting a goal is not the main thing. It is deciding how you will go about achieving it and staying with that plan.

Tom Landry, football coach


It is better to ask some of the questions than to know all the answers.

James Thurber, author


It is always the best policy to tell the truth, unless, of course, you're an exceptionally good liar.

Jerome K. Jerome, author


Don't fight forces. Use them.

Buckminster Fuller, architect


The greatest problem with communication is the illusion that is has been accomplished once and for all.

George Bernard Shaw, playwright, essayist


In the long run, we shape our lives and we shape ourselves. The process never ends until we die. And the choices we make are ultimately our own responsibility.

Eleanor Roosevelt, diplomat, author, humanitarian


It is easier to do the job right than to explain why you didn't.

Martin Van Buren, U.S. president, 1837-1841
